excel单元格变成了整数
作者:excel问答网
|
141人看过
发布时间:2026-01-12 10:28:00
标签:
Excel单元格变成了整数:深层原因、影响与应对策略在Excel中,单元格数据的格式设置是影响数据呈现和计算结果的重要因素。在许多情况下,用户可能发现单元格中的数据从“文本”变成了“整数”,这往往伴随着数据的丢失或计算结果的异常变化。
Excel单元格变成了整数:深层原因、影响与应对策略
在Excel中,单元格数据的格式设置是影响数据呈现和计算结果的重要因素。在许多情况下,用户可能发现单元格中的数据从“文本”变成了“整数”,这往往伴随着数据的丢失或计算结果的异常变化。本文将深入探讨Excel单元格为何会出现这种情况,并分析其背后的原因、影响以及应对策略。
一、Excel单元格变成整数的常见情况
在Excel中,单元格的默认格式为“文本”,当用户输入数据时,如果没有特别设置,Excel会保留原始数据的格式。然而,当用户对单元格进行格式设置时,可能会出现数据被转换为整数的情况。这种转换通常发生在以下几种场景中:
1. 单元格格式设置为“整数”
当用户将单元格格式设置为“整数”时,Excel会自动将单元格中的数值转换为整数,去除小数部分。例如,输入“12.5”,如果单元格格式设置为“整数”,则会显示为“12”。
2. 数据来源为整数型数据
如果数据本身是整数型,例如从数据库或CSV文件导入的数据,Excel可能会自动将其转换为整数,而忽略小数部分。
3. 数据被强制转换为整数
在某些情况下,用户可能通过公式或函数(如INT、ROUND等)来强制转换数据为整数。例如,使用公式 `=INT(A1)` 会将A1中的数值转换为整数。
4. 数据被复制粘贴时格式丢失
如果用户从其他软件(如Word、PPT或其他电子表格)复制数据到Excel,数据格式可能会被丢失,导致单元格显示为整数。
二、Excel单元格变成整数的原因分析
1. 单元格格式设置为“整数”
这是最常见的一种情况。Excel的“格式设置”功能允许用户定义单元格的显示格式。如果用户将单元格格式设置为“整数”,Excel会自动将数据转换为整数,忽略小数部分。这种行为虽然方便,但可能带来数据丢失的风险。
2. 数据源的格式问题
如果数据源本身是整数型数据,例如从数据库或CSV导入,Excel会自动将其识别为整数,而不会保留小数部分。这种情况下,用户可能不了解数据的原始格式,导致单元格显示为整数。
3. 公式或函数的使用
用户在使用公式时,可能会无意间使用了转换为整数的函数,如 `=INT(A1)` 或 `=ROUND(A1, 0)`,这些函数会将数据转换为整数。虽然这些函数在某些情况下是必要的,但用户应谨慎使用,以避免数据丢失。
4. 数据复制粘贴的格式丢失
当用户从其他软件(如Word、PPT)复制数据到Excel时,数据格式可能会被丢失。例如,Word中的文本可能会被Excel自动识别为整数,导致单元格显示为整数。
三、Excel单元格变成整数的影响
1. 数据显示异常
当单元格显示为整数时,用户可能无法看到数据的完整信息。例如,输入“12.5”并设置为“整数”后,单元格会显示为“12”,而用户可能误以为数据已经完整。
2. 计算结果错误
在进行计算时,如果单元格显示为整数,计算结果可能会出现偏差。例如,如果A1是“12.5”,B1是“12”,那么计算 `=A1+B1` 会得到“24.5”,但如果A1显示为“12”,B1显示为“12”,则计算结果会是“24”。
3. 数据丢失风险
当单元格显示为整数时,数据可能会被截断,导致信息丢失。例如,如果用户输入“12.5”,并将其设置为整数,那么“12.5”会被显示为“12”,而“0.5”会被显示为“0”。
四、Excel单元格变成整数的应对策略
1. 检查单元格格式设置
用户应检查单元格的格式设置,确保其未被设置为“整数”。如果单元格已经设置为“整数”,可以尝试将其恢复为“文本”格式,以保留数据的完整性。
2. 检查数据源格式
如果数据来源是整数型数据,用户应检查数据源的格式设置,确保数据在导入Excel时保持原始格式。如果数据源是文本型数据,应确保单元格格式设置为“文本”,以便保留小数部分。
3. 使用公式或函数时谨慎操作
用户在使用公式或函数时,应避免使用可能将数据转换为整数的函数。如果必须转换为整数,应确保数据本身是整数,以避免不必要的数据丢失。
4. 复制粘贴数据时注意格式
当从其他软件复制数据到Excel时,应确保数据的格式与Excel兼容。如果数据格式不兼容,可能导致单元格显示为整数。用户应检查数据源的格式,并确保复制粘贴时保留原始格式。
5. 使用Excel的“数据验证”功能
用户可以使用Excel的“数据验证”功能,确保单元格的数据格式符合要求。如果数据格式需要保持为文本,可以设置数据验证规则,防止数据被自动转换为整数。
五、Excel单元格变成整数的实际案例分析
案例1:从Word复制数据到Excel
假设用户从Word中复制了“12.5”文本,粘贴到Excel中,由于Word和Excel的格式不同,Excel会自动将其转换为整数,显示为“12”。
案例2:使用函数转换数据
用户使用公式 `=INT(A1)`,将A1中的数据转换为整数,导致单元格显示为整数,而用户可能误以为数据已经正确。
案例3:数据源为整数型数据
用户从数据库导入数据,数据本身是整数型,Excel自动将其转换为整数,导致单元格显示为整数。
案例4:数据复制粘贴时格式丢失
用户从PPT复制数据到Excel,数据格式被丢失,导致单元格显示为整数。
六、总结
Excel单元格变成整数是由于单元格格式设置、数据源格式、公式使用或数据复制粘贴等多种原因导致的。用户应根据具体情况进行检查和调整,以确保数据的完整性和准确性。在使用Excel时,应特别注意数据格式的设置,避免不必要的数据丢失或计算错误。通过合理设置单元格格式、检查数据源格式、使用合适的公式和函数,用户可以有效避免Excel单元格变成整数的问题。
在Excel中,单元格数据的格式设置是影响数据呈现和计算结果的重要因素。在许多情况下,用户可能发现单元格中的数据从“文本”变成了“整数”,这往往伴随着数据的丢失或计算结果的异常变化。本文将深入探讨Excel单元格为何会出现这种情况,并分析其背后的原因、影响以及应对策略。
一、Excel单元格变成整数的常见情况
在Excel中,单元格的默认格式为“文本”,当用户输入数据时,如果没有特别设置,Excel会保留原始数据的格式。然而,当用户对单元格进行格式设置时,可能会出现数据被转换为整数的情况。这种转换通常发生在以下几种场景中:
1. 单元格格式设置为“整数”
当用户将单元格格式设置为“整数”时,Excel会自动将单元格中的数值转换为整数,去除小数部分。例如,输入“12.5”,如果单元格格式设置为“整数”,则会显示为“12”。
2. 数据来源为整数型数据
如果数据本身是整数型,例如从数据库或CSV文件导入的数据,Excel可能会自动将其转换为整数,而忽略小数部分。
3. 数据被强制转换为整数
在某些情况下,用户可能通过公式或函数(如INT、ROUND等)来强制转换数据为整数。例如,使用公式 `=INT(A1)` 会将A1中的数值转换为整数。
4. 数据被复制粘贴时格式丢失
如果用户从其他软件(如Word、PPT或其他电子表格)复制数据到Excel,数据格式可能会被丢失,导致单元格显示为整数。
二、Excel单元格变成整数的原因分析
1. 单元格格式设置为“整数”
这是最常见的一种情况。Excel的“格式设置”功能允许用户定义单元格的显示格式。如果用户将单元格格式设置为“整数”,Excel会自动将数据转换为整数,忽略小数部分。这种行为虽然方便,但可能带来数据丢失的风险。
2. 数据源的格式问题
如果数据源本身是整数型数据,例如从数据库或CSV导入,Excel会自动将其识别为整数,而不会保留小数部分。这种情况下,用户可能不了解数据的原始格式,导致单元格显示为整数。
3. 公式或函数的使用
用户在使用公式时,可能会无意间使用了转换为整数的函数,如 `=INT(A1)` 或 `=ROUND(A1, 0)`,这些函数会将数据转换为整数。虽然这些函数在某些情况下是必要的,但用户应谨慎使用,以避免数据丢失。
4. 数据复制粘贴的格式丢失
当用户从其他软件(如Word、PPT)复制数据到Excel时,数据格式可能会被丢失。例如,Word中的文本可能会被Excel自动识别为整数,导致单元格显示为整数。
三、Excel单元格变成整数的影响
1. 数据显示异常
当单元格显示为整数时,用户可能无法看到数据的完整信息。例如,输入“12.5”并设置为“整数”后,单元格会显示为“12”,而用户可能误以为数据已经完整。
2. 计算结果错误
在进行计算时,如果单元格显示为整数,计算结果可能会出现偏差。例如,如果A1是“12.5”,B1是“12”,那么计算 `=A1+B1` 会得到“24.5”,但如果A1显示为“12”,B1显示为“12”,则计算结果会是“24”。
3. 数据丢失风险
当单元格显示为整数时,数据可能会被截断,导致信息丢失。例如,如果用户输入“12.5”,并将其设置为整数,那么“12.5”会被显示为“12”,而“0.5”会被显示为“0”。
四、Excel单元格变成整数的应对策略
1. 检查单元格格式设置
用户应检查单元格的格式设置,确保其未被设置为“整数”。如果单元格已经设置为“整数”,可以尝试将其恢复为“文本”格式,以保留数据的完整性。
2. 检查数据源格式
如果数据来源是整数型数据,用户应检查数据源的格式设置,确保数据在导入Excel时保持原始格式。如果数据源是文本型数据,应确保单元格格式设置为“文本”,以便保留小数部分。
3. 使用公式或函数时谨慎操作
用户在使用公式或函数时,应避免使用可能将数据转换为整数的函数。如果必须转换为整数,应确保数据本身是整数,以避免不必要的数据丢失。
4. 复制粘贴数据时注意格式
当从其他软件复制数据到Excel时,应确保数据的格式与Excel兼容。如果数据格式不兼容,可能导致单元格显示为整数。用户应检查数据源的格式,并确保复制粘贴时保留原始格式。
5. 使用Excel的“数据验证”功能
用户可以使用Excel的“数据验证”功能,确保单元格的数据格式符合要求。如果数据格式需要保持为文本,可以设置数据验证规则,防止数据被自动转换为整数。
五、Excel单元格变成整数的实际案例分析
案例1:从Word复制数据到Excel
假设用户从Word中复制了“12.5”文本,粘贴到Excel中,由于Word和Excel的格式不同,Excel会自动将其转换为整数,显示为“12”。
案例2:使用函数转换数据
用户使用公式 `=INT(A1)`,将A1中的数据转换为整数,导致单元格显示为整数,而用户可能误以为数据已经正确。
案例3:数据源为整数型数据
用户从数据库导入数据,数据本身是整数型,Excel自动将其转换为整数,导致单元格显示为整数。
案例4:数据复制粘贴时格式丢失
用户从PPT复制数据到Excel,数据格式被丢失,导致单元格显示为整数。
六、总结
Excel单元格变成整数是由于单元格格式设置、数据源格式、公式使用或数据复制粘贴等多种原因导致的。用户应根据具体情况进行检查和调整,以确保数据的完整性和准确性。在使用Excel时,应特别注意数据格式的设置,避免不必要的数据丢失或计算错误。通过合理设置单元格格式、检查数据源格式、使用合适的公式和函数,用户可以有效避免Excel单元格变成整数的问题。
推荐文章
Excel 如何隐藏其他单元格:实用技巧与深度解析在Excel中,数据的展示方式对工作效率有着直接的影响。有时,我们可能需要隐藏一些单元格,以避免干扰数据的查看或防止他人误操作。本文将详细介绍Excel中隐藏单元格的多种方法,从基础操
2026-01-12 10:27:28
169人看过
Excel单元格怎么设置长度:深度解析与实用技巧在Excel中,单元格是数据处理和展示的基本单位。每个单元格都有一个特定的长度,这个长度决定了单元格中可以显示的内容数量。设置单元格的长度,是提升数据管理效率、避免数据溢出、确保数据显示
2026-01-12 10:26:17
225人看过
Excel 2003 单元格数据处理详解:从基础到高级在Excel 2003中,单元格数据的处理是日常工作中的核心内容。无论是数据录入、公式计算,还是格式化显示,单元格都是数据的承载单位。本文将从单元格的基本结构、数据类型、数据操作、
2026-01-12 10:25:01
49人看过
Excel单元格表单控件修改:深度解析与实用指南在Excel中,单元格表单控件(Form Controls)是用户与数据交互的重要方式之一。通过表单控件,用户可以实现数据输入、验证、计算和操作,提升数据处理的效率和用户体验。本文将深入
2026-01-12 10:19:44
321人看过
.webp)
.webp)

.webp)